Marine Mart Opens in Mississauga

Marine Mart

Apr 11, 2017

Marine Mart Inc. opened it first store outside the province of Quebec on Match 31 in the City of Mississauga. When the bell rung at 9AM, many of Marine Mart’s suppliers were on hand to wish them well.

The large warehouse style store is located at 1590 Dundas Street East near Dixie Road.

George Gary StevensThe company already has six locations in the Montreal and Greater Ottawa regions and trades under the banners; L’Entrepôt Marine, Marine Mart and AMMA Marine.

George Bailey with sons Gary and Steve at their first Ontario store on opening day, March 31st, 2017

The AMMA brand is exclusive to Marine Mart and as owner George Bailey proudly says, adding“the products are very competitive”.

The 50,000 plus after market products carried by Marine Mart serve both the small and large boat sectors, sail & power. Marine Mart also has a very active online sales program.
